SIC classification

SIC 28220 — Manufacture of lifting and handling equipment

Includes

manufacture of hand-operated or power-driven lifting, handling, loading or unloading machinery:, pulley tackle and hoists, winches, capstans and jacks, derricks, cranes, mobile lifting frames, straddle carriers etc., works trucks, whether or not fitted with lifting or handling equipment, whether or not self-propelled, of the type used in factories (including hand trucks and wheelbarrows), mechanical manipulators and industrial robots specifically designed for lifting, handling, loading or unloading, manufacture of conveyors, teleferics etc., manufacture of lifts, escalators and moving walkways, manufacture of parts specialised for lifting and handling equipment

Excludes

manufacture of industrial robots for multiple uses, see ##28.99, manufacture of continuous-action elevators and conveyors for underground use, see ##28.92, manufacture of mechanical shovels, excavators and shovel loaders, see ##28.92, manufacture of floating cranes, railway cranes, crane-lorries, see ##30.11, ##30.20, installation of lifts and elevators, see ##43.29
